The LIST_POISON feature in include/linux/poison.h in the Linux kernel
before 4.3, as used in Android 6.0.1 before 2016-03-01, does not properly
consider the relationship to the mmap_min_addr value, which makes it easier
for attackers to bypass a poison-pointer protection mechanism by triggering
the use of an uninitialized list entry, aka Android internal bug 26186802,
a different vulnerability than CVE-2015-3636.
